我有一个网站,我使用的是css bootstrap affix menu。
由于菜单的长度,我需要在屏幕不够长时添加自动垂直滚动条。
我在容器scrollspy-y-fix
元素上添加了一个名为ul
的类,并在容器<nav class="col-sm-3">
中添加了一个类,以强制在屏幕小于菜单时显示滚动条。
.scrollspy-y-fix { 身高:100vh!important; overflow-y:auto!important; }
除了我使用MacBook Pro之外,它似乎在所有浏览器中都运行良好。在使用Safari或谷歌浏览器的MacBook上,我没有滚动条。菜单有一半可见,我无法向下滚动以查看菜单底部的项目。
以下是评估网站https://crestapps.com/laravel-code-generator/docs/1.0
如何解决此问题?
以下是我MacBook Pro的截图。如您所见,没有滚动条。
此外,在常规屏幕PC上,当我向下滚动页面时,菜单上的所选项目不会改变。知道为什么吗?
答案 0 :(得分:0)
尝试添加“overflow:scroll;”到了css。